Something else I have thought of, how extendable is the icalendar format? \
Something I had done in Outlook was to create an additional page on all the \
forms for more tracking information. Some compainies really kill people \
with paperwork so I would use my calendar entries to keep track of things. \
For example when I went to a client site, I would use the catagories to \
mark the trip as billable or non billable, etc. Then I had a seperate \
field where I kept track of the p.o. number is was billed to. I could view \
my calendar in a different format and be able to quickly see the catagories \
and filled in p.o. numbers and such. This example isn't real good as you \
could easily say, just use the p.o. number in the catagory field as \
billable and a blank catagory as nonbillable, but I had a lot more \
catagories than what were in my example here. So basically what I'm saying \
is there any support of user defined fields in the ical/vcal standards and \
could this be implemented easily?
